Q76. **An amount of Rs. 3000 becomes Rs. 3600 in four years at simple interest. If the rate of interest was 1% more, then what was be the total amount?**

  1.  Rs. 3800
  2.  Rs. 3780
  3.  Rs. 3720
  4.  Cannot be determined

Solution : Rs. 3720
Q77. **A certain sum becomes four times itself at simple interest in eight years. In how many years does it become ten times itself?**

  1.  21
  2.  26
  3.  23
  4.  None of these

Solution : None of these
Q78. **At what rate of interest is an amount doubled in two years, when compounded annually?**

  1.  30%
  2.  41.4%
  3.  45.2%
  4.  73.2%

Solution : 41.4%
Q79. **Vijay lent out an amount Rs. 10000 into two parts, one at 8% p.a. and the remaining at 10% p.a. both on simple interest. At the end of the year he received Rs. 890 as total interest. What was the amount he lent out at 8% pa.a?**

  1.  Rs. 6000
  2.  Rs. 5500
  3.  Rs. 4500
  4.  Rs. 5000

Solution : Rs. 5500

Q80. **Anil invested a sum of money at a certain rate of simple interest for a period of five years. Had he invested the sum for a period of eight years for the same rate, the total intrest earned by him would have been sixty percent more than the earlier interest amount. Find the rate of interest p.a.**

  1.  6%
  2.  9%
  3.  12.5%
  4.  Cannot be determined

Solution : Cannot be determined
